callas software announced a newer version 2.3 of callas pdfaPilot, its PDF/A creation software. The new version fully supports all features of PDF/A-2 in regard to document validation and conversion. Additionally, the newer version is 64-bit enabled and features number of other enhancements.

PDF/A Competence Centre (PDFACC) has launched its UK Chapter to assist UK-based customers and companies that offer PDF/A products and services. The launch of UK Chapter is marked with a series of educational seminars with the first seminar in London on 19th November.

The PDF/A Conference Center has organised the 4th International PDF/A Conference in Rome, Italy from 29th September to 1st October 2010. The conference offers technical presentations from experts in PDF/A, workshops for practical hands-on experience and discussions on various PDF/A topics.

LuraTech announced that callas software GmbH has developed a third-party PDF conversion module for LuraTech’s DocYard, its document conversion platform. The module developed by callas software is called pdfaPilot 2 and it integrates the ability to convert digital file formats to PDF/A into the workflow of the DocYard platform.

Within 5 years, PDF is expected to be in use as a long-term storage format by 93% of the organizations surveyed in the AIIM research report, Content Creation and Delivery – The On-Ramps and Off-Ramps of ECM.

BCL’s easyPDF SDK 6.0 now supports: 64-bit versions of Windows 2003/2008/Vista/XP; PDF/A Standard for long term archiving of electronic documents; PDF/X Standard for exchange of print-ready PDF files in printing/advertising industries.
